Introduction
Spathodea Nilotica, also known as the African tulip tree, is a species of flowering plant native to tropical Africa. It belongs to the Bignoniaceae family and is known for its vibrant red or orange flowers that bloom in clusters. Botanical Characteristics
Spathodea Nilotica is a large tree that can grow up to 25 meters in height. It has a thick trunk with a rough, grey bark and large, glossy green leaves that are arranged in opposite pairs. The flowers of the African tulip tree are trumpet-shaped and can measure up to 10 centimeters in diameter. They are typically red or orange in color, although some varieties may have yellow or pink flowers.
Habitat
Spathodea Nilotica is native to tropical Africa, where it can be found in countries such as Nigeria, Ghana, and Cameroon. It thrives in hot, humid climates and is often found growing in forests, along riverbanks, and in urban areas. The African tulip tree is a fast-growing species that can adapt to a wide range of soil types, although it prefers well-drained, fertile soil.

Ecological Impact
While Spathodea Nilotica is prized for its beauty and utility, it can also have a negative impact on the environment. The tree is considered invasive in some regions, where it can outcompete native plant species and disrupt local ecosystems. In areas where the African tulip tree is not native, efforts are being made to control its spread and protect biodiversity.
